  • I agree with previous posters. Make sure you are logging correctly. I thought I was doing everything right , wasn't losing the weight, then I bought a food scale. And the weight has been consistently coming off.

  • I finally bought one this week. Boy was I shocked at the difference in calories. I have been losing very slowly at about 1lb per month and now understand it's because I've only been eating slightly below maintenance. A food scale is definitely worth the money. Takes all the guess work out.
